Andayani's profits fall
JAKARTA (JP): PT Andayani Megah, a publicly listed tire cord producer, booked a net profit of Rp 11.34 billion (US$4.9 million) in the first quarter of this year, a 26 percent drop from Rp 15.34 billion in the corresponding period of 1995.
The company announced yesterday that its consolidated sales from January to March rose 8 percent to Rp 49 billion over the same period of last year.
Approximately 63 percent of the company's consolidated sales went to its parent company, PT Gadjah Tunggal, while 5 percent was sold to other Indonesian tire producers and 32 percent was exported to overseas tire producers.
The company's earnings per share dropped to Rp 35 in the first quarter of 1995 from Rp 48 in the same period of 1995.(hen)
